Be it known that I, ALFONSO ORIOL, asubject of the United States, residing at town of Balanga, Bataan Province, Philippine Islands, have invented a new and useful Joint Adjustable Handle; and I do hereby declare the following to be afull, clear, and exact description of the invention, suchas will enable others skilled in the art to which it appertains to make and use the same.
This invention relates to a new and useful improved jointed adjustable handle, adapted for use in connection with various tools, such as monkey wrenches, pipe wrenches, screw drivers and the like.
An object of the invention is the provision of a handle that may be turned or adjusted at right angles to the tool, as shown in Figure 1, whereby a cranking motion may be imparted to the tool, for applying or-removing a nut.
A feature of the invention is the provision of an apertured lug at one end of the tool and provided with a recess adjoining said lug, in combination with a handle bifurcated at one end to receive the apertured lug, which bifurcated end is provided with notches to receive lugs of a transverse pin,
Which is mounted in said recess of the tool,
there beinga spring to hold' the lugs-of the pin in the notches of the bifurcated end of the handle. p In practical fields the details of construction may necessitate alterations, to which the patentee is entitled,- provided the alterations fall within the scope of what is The invention comprises further features and combination of parts, as hereinafter set forth, shown in the drawings and claimed.

Referring more particu arly to the draw: ings, l designates a tool, one end ofwhich is provided with a reduced apertured lug 2 Specification of Letters Patent.

in the tool adjoining the notch 3. The handle 5 at one end is provided with a bi furcation 6 to receive the lug 2, the e being a screw bolt 7 passing through the lugs 8 and 9 (between which the bifurcation 6 is formed) and the lug 2, thereby,
connecting the handle 5 to'the tool. The
lugs 8 and 9 are provided with a series of notches 10, any two opposite notches of which receive the lugs 11 and 12 of the pin 13, which is arranged in the recess 4, there being a spring 14; interposed between the shoulder 15 of the pin 13 and the shoulder 16'at one end of the recess 4, which spring holds the pin 13 in a position as shown in Fig.3, with the lugs 11 and 12 in engage ment' with any two opposite notches 10- The object in providing the notch 3 is to afford suitable means to receive the lug 12, when the pin 13 is depressed to remove the lugs 11 and 12 from the notches 10, when the handle 5 is being adjusted. The pin 7' 1s threaded into the lug 9. By depressing the pin 13, the handle 5 may be adjusted, at various angles or positions relative to the tool, as shown in Figs. 1 and 2.
